File types

To view the list of file types recognized by IntelliJ IDEA, go to Settings/Preferences (Ctrl+Alt+S) | Editor | File Types. If a file in your project is marked with the unknown file type icon, it indicates that IntelliJ IDEA can't recognize it. In this case, you can register and configure a new file type.

Bookmarks

bookmarkCheck

Anonymous bookmark – a check sign bookmark. Bookmarks are used for quick navigation within a file or across the entire project.

bookmarkMnemonic

Lettered mnemonic bookmark – a letter in the interval from A to Z.

bookmarkNumber

Numbered mnemonic bookmark – a number in the interval from 0 to 9.
